albert@spenarnc.xs4all.nl writes:
> Numbers (also denotations, such as strings)  must be smart.

I've thought of having non-smart numbers in a small Forth.  Instead of
123 you would say # 123 or something similar, where # is a parsing word
that emits LIT and the number.  I remember that the eForth metacompiler
does something like that, to handle the case where the host and target
processors have differing number representations (e.g. word sizes).
